Structural Integrity and Thermal administration: the muse of Longevity

The physical development of an LED fixture may be the bedrock upon which its lifespan is developed. warmth is the primary adversary of LED performance and longevity. surplus heat accelerates the degradation of your LED chip and other Digital factors, bringing about untimely failure and diminished mild output. thus, optimizing the merchandise structure for economical heat dissipation is paramount for extending provider daily life and, As a result, offering environmental Positive aspects.

substantial-good quality resources Participate in a crucial role. employing high quality-quality aluminum for that luminaire housing, For illustration, offers superior thermal conductivity in comparison with less costly alloys or plastics. Aluminum acts as a successful heat sink, drawing thermal Vitality far from the delicate LED modules and dissipating it in the bordering setting. Complementing this, sturdy polycarbonate (Laptop) diffusers not merely make certain even light distribution but also possess superior thermal resistance, protecting against warmth buildup close to The sunshine supply and sustaining structural integrity with time.

past supplies, innovative thermal management procedure layout is vital. This includes engineering interior pathways for airflow, optimizing The location and geometry of warmth sinks, and ensuring a secure thermal connection in between the LED board and the heat-dissipating things. By successfully taking care of running temperatures and avoiding overheating, producers can drastically slow down the growing old process of the LEDs and affiliated electronics.

The environmental payoff is direct: Improved thermal performance translates right into a decreased failure price. A fixture created to past lengthier inherently cuts down the frequency of replacements. What this means is fewer resources are eaten in producing new models, much less Electrical power is expended inside the output course of action, and the demand from customers for raw resources is lessened. cutting down failures for the resource is usually a elementary move in minimizing the environmental effects affiliated with lighting infrastructure.

the center with the make any difference: superior-Longevity LED Main engineering

While the framework presents the necessary aid technique, the standard of the LED chip itself is central to accomplishing real extended-existence functionality. The Main light-weight source dictates not simply the First effectiveness but also how nicely the fixture maintains its brightness and steadiness above Countless hours of operation.

deciding on substantial-efficacy chips from dependable producers is a essential layout choice. These top quality LEDs are engineered for slower lumen depreciation – the gradual minimize in mild output with time. Inferior chips could knowledge immediate brightness decay, indicating the fixture consumes just about the same level of Power but creates appreciably much less gentle. This represents a hidden form of Strength squander. A fixture Outfitted with high-longevity chips maintains its valuable mild output for much longer, making sure that the Strength eaten proceeds to translate into productive illumination.

Moreover, large-top quality chips show bigger stability and reliability. These are less vulnerable to colour shifts or sudden failures. This Increased balance immediately impacts routine maintenance cycles. Fixtures that continually complete as expected involve much less frequent servicing and intervention. For large installations, this translates into considerable environmental savings by lessening the necessity for upkeep crews, support vehicles, and replacement components, all of that have their own carbon footprints. By purchasing a exceptional LED Main, makers make sure the luminaire provides sustained overall performance, reducing both Power squander because of inefficiency plus the environmental burden of Recurrent routine maintenance.

Stemming the Tide of E-squander: A More Rhythmic Approach to Recycling

Electronic waste, or e-waste, has become the swiftest-rising squander streams globally, posing significant environmental challenges resulting from the doubtless dangerous components contained within just electronic elements. LED fixtures, that contains circuit boards, drivers, and semiconductor chips, add to this stream upon disposal. developing for longevity is a crucial system for mitigating the e-waste problem linked to lights.

When LED fixtures have a short lifespan, they lead to a immediate cycle of obsolescence and disposal. This may lead to surges in e-squander, frustrating existing recycling infrastructure and rising the potential risk of inappropriate disposal, in which damaging substances can leach into soil and drinking water. By significantly extending the operational lifetime of LED luminaires, producers properly decelerate this alternative cycle.

an extended item daily life signifies that fixtures continue to be in provider For a lot of a lot more several years, delaying their entry into your waste stream. This generates a far more manageable, rhythmic flow of conclude-of-lifestyle items, making it possible for recycling facilities and waste administration systems to manage the quantity extra properly. Furthermore, it lowers the force on firms and consumers to regularly take care of the disposal and likely recycling expenses associated with Recurrent replacements. Delaying the development of squander is actually a elementary theory of environmental stewardship, and very long-existence design achieves specifically this, obtaining precious time for the event of more efficient and complete recycling methods and lessening the rapid load on landfill capability.

Operational performance and inexperienced developing Synergies

for giant-scale lights projects – such as industrial amenities, warehouses, parking garages, workshops, or substantial custom made garage lighting installations – the operational and routine maintenance (O&M) implications of fixture lifespan are sizeable. lengthy-everyday living design and style provides sizeable pros in decreasing O&M fees, which often have their own personal environmental footprint, and contributes positively to acquiring sustainable making certifications.

In huge installations, changing unsuccessful luminaires will not be a trivial job. It frequently involves specialized devices like scissor lifts or increase lifts, notably for top ceilings, consuming Electricity and requiring qualified labor. Recurrent replacements translate into recurring maintenance schedules, enhanced labor several hours, and likely operational disruptions. An LED system made for longevity substantially cuts down the frequency of such interventions. This not only saves direct expenses and also minimizes the environmental influence connected to routine maintenance functions – significantly less gas burned by services cars, minimized want for Power-intense entry machines, and fewer squander produced from changed pieces.

Also, the thrust in direction of sustainable constructing practices has led into the popular adoption of inexperienced setting up ranking units like LEED (Leadership in Electrical power and Environmental style) and very well. These frameworks generally award factors for methods that improve setting up efficiency and reduce environmental effects over the constructing's lifecycle. Specifying very long-everyday living lighting fixtures can lead to attaining credits related to elements and resources (e.g., squander reduction) and operational effectiveness. tough, small-routine maintenance lights units align perfectly With all the aims of creating buildings that are not only Power-productive but in addition resource-efficient and sustainable to operate about the long term.
